About KIIT School of Law

KIIT School of Law (KSOL), a constituent of Kalinga Institute of Industrial Technology (KIIT) Deemed to be University, is one of India’s premier law schools, committed to excellence in legal education, research, and professional development. Established with the vision of nurturing socially responsible and globally competent legal professionals, the School of Law offers a dynamic and rigorous academic environment that integrates theoretical foundations with practical application.

Details About The Event

The 1st KIIT International Moot Court Competition, hosted by the esteemed KIIT SCHOOL OF LAWin association with NaniPalkhivala Arbitration Centre (NPAC) as our Knowledge and Academic Partnerwith a moot proposition drafted by the renowned law firm WadiaGhandy and Co., exploring the realms of International Commercial Arbitration, presents a unique opportunity for law students across the globe to challenge themselves intellectually and gain unparalleled exposure in the field of international law and dispute resolution.

Who Is It For/ Eligibility To Participate

The competition shall be open for law students who are duly enrolled and are pursuing an integrated 5-year or 3-year law program from any college or university recognised by the Bar Council of India.
